The Sunset by Sun Property: Experience Breathtaking Phu Quoc Sunsets

In December 2025, Sun Property, a proud member of Sun Group, unveiled The Sunset, an exclusive subdivision nestled on Ông Quán Mountain. This prime location offers breathtaking sunset views over Ngọc Island and grants residents access to the luxurious amenities of Sunset Town.

The Sunset District stands as a pivotal project in preparation for APEC 2027, comprising four high-rise towers nestled on the slopes of Mount Ong Quan. This prime location is enveloped by Sun Group’s vibrant ecosystem on the Pearl Island.

Adjacent to already operational residential towers like The Sea, The Hill, and The Sky within the Sun Grand City Hillside Residence project launched nearly five years ago, The Sunset represents the final residential phase in Sunset Town. It completes a vibrant, experience-rich mosaic for both residents and visitors.

What sets The Sunset apart is its unparalleled location, boasting one of the highest elevations in Sunset Town, perched on the slopes of Mount Ong Quan. This vantage point offers breathtaking, unobstructed views of Sunset Town, crowned as the “World’s Leading Iconic Tourist Destination 2025” by the World Travel Awards. From this prime position, the full splendor of Phu Quoc’s sunset unfolds, unmarred by surrounding structures, revealing a vast expanse of sea and sky. This is the ultimate vantage point to directly face the iconic Hon Bridge and Sunset Town.

Beyond the iconic sunsets that define Phu Quoc’s allure for travelers and enthusiasts, The Sunset offers a 360-degree panoramic view, among the finest on Pearl Island. While the west side unveils a vibrant festival atmosphere as dusk falls, the east-facing units greet the pristine dawn over Sun Grand City New An Thoi and Bai Kem. The southern view captures Bai Xep and the world’s longest three-rope cable car system, while the north offers a sweeping vista of the APEC Conference Center under construction at Dat Do Beach.

Inspired by Eastern philosophy, The Sunset’s design draws upon the protective deities of the land. Each tower embodies a unique narrative and significance: Ong Thach (Stone Guardian), Ong Hoa (Fire Guardian), Ong May (Cloud Guardian), and Ong Lam (Forest Guardian), symbolizing distinct natural energies harmoniously unified within the complex.

With a diverse range of units, from studios and one- to two-bedroom apartments to limited penthouses, The Sunset offers flexible living solutions. Ideal for permanent residence, periodic vacations, or rental investment, the project is poised to capitalize on the influx of visitors to Sunset Town. Each unit features spacious balconies, ample natural light, and optimized airflow, minimizing blind spots.

Notably, the income-generating apartment model empowers owners to manage their units independently, catering to the growing demand for upscale accommodations among international business professionals and experts.
